Chugong’sSolo Levelingis an exciting seriesthat focuses on Sung Jinwoo’s journey of self-discovery and rise to power. Although fans praise it for its brilliant storytelling and high-stakes fights, the manhwa has also received criticism for being hyper-focused on the protagonist.

Interestingly,Solo Levelingdoes feature several compelling side characters who deserve more attention. While some of them have interesting origin stories, others are gifted with powers that put them on par with the Gods.If a spinoff manhwa were ever written, these characters would not only be the right fit but would also add more depth to the overall narrative, expanding the lore beyond Sung Jinwoo.

7Choi Jong-In

Leader Of The Hunters Guild

Choi Jong-Inis not overpowered like the other characters on this list, but he is still a decent hunter. He is also the guild master of the Hunters Guild and has played a crucial role in shaping hunter policies in Korea.

Choi has himself participated in several high-stakes raids in the past, and each one of them has been instrumental in thestruggle against otherworldly magical beasts. His level-headed thinking and leadership qualities make him an ideal main character for a manhwa. Interestingly, not much is known about Jong-In’s background, so a spinoff could also shed light on that, uncovering his backstory and perhaps even his reasons for becoming a hunter.

6Ashborn

Monarch Of Shadows

Ashbornis one of the most powerful beingsin existence. Although the original manhwa does explore his origin story, the war he participated in lasted eons, and many of the details are obviously glossed over. While a spinoff manhwa does not necessarily have to cover every detail, it could still be an exciting series focused on the major events that transpired during those years.

Ashborn’s character development could serve as the emotional core of the story, while also revealing more details about the other Monarchs. Fans will probably appreciate a manhwa that goes in-depth when discussing the origins of the conflict that eventually led to the spawning of the mysterious Gates in the human world.

5Liu Zhigang

China’s 7th Star Hunter

China’sLiu Zhigangis one of the greatest hunters to have ever lived. It’s unfortunate that, despite being so influential, he barely gets the spotlight in the original manhwa. His explosive fighting style makes him an ideal character to lead a spinoff series that focuses on his adventures, specifically in China.

Zhigang also fought the dragon Kamish, so a manhwa revolving around him could potentially include the devastating battle that unfolded on the west coast of America followingthe first S-rank dungeon break.

4Sung Il-Hwan

Jinwoo’s Father

Sung Il-Hwanhas to beone of the most mysterious characters in the series. He became a top hunterafter experiencing an awakeningwhile working as a firefighter. When he got trapped inside a Gate, his family and his identity were taken from him in the blink of an eye.

Despite the insurmountable odds, Il-Hwan survived the ordeal and emerged from a Gate in America several years later. However, much of his life remains a mystery to fans, especially his mystical powers. A spinoff manhwa focused on him could offer a better understanding of his relationship with his family and shed light on the events that transpired while he was stuck in the dungeon. It might also explore his life before he met Park and reveal untold aspects of his journey.

3Go Gunhee

Chairman Of The Korean Hunter Association

ChairmanGunheeis one of the most experienced hunters in the world. He is also one of thefirst S-rankers from Koreaand fought many high-stakes battles in his heyday. Although he is no longer healthy enough to continue working as a hunter, he is always itching to fight beasts and protect civilians.

Gunhee’s selfless nature makes him an excellent prospect to lead a spinoff manhwa. His life is shrouded in mystery, and a series primarily focused on him could answer several questions about the emergence of Gates in the human world.

2Thomas Andre

America’s Greatest Hunter

Thomas Andreis ranked as the strongest hunterin the world. He also leads the Scavenger Guild and fought the first S-rank dungeon boss, Kamish. A spinoff manhwa focused on his life would be exciting. He comes from an impoverished household and struggled a lot to get to where he is.

Andre’s story of rising against insurmountable odds would be inspiring for fans. The spinoff can also add more context to the original timeline and offer viewers a better understanding of the evolution of power dynamics in the hunter world before Jinwoo’s rise.

1Cha Hae-In

The Dancer

Cha Hae-Inis an ideal characterto lead a spin-off manhwa. She is loved by the fans, and her backstory is quite intriguing. Although she was once a well-known track athlete, her career ended abruptly following an injury. She eventually experienced an awakening and went on to become Korea’s 9th S-ranker.

Cha Hae-In’s rise as a hunter was meteoric, but since the story isso hyper-focused on Sung Jinwoo, her struggles and sacrifices are barely mentioned. Her backstory, filled with ups and downs, is quite interesting and could serve as the ideal foundation for a dedicated spinoff. Stories with strong female characters are rare, and fans would surely love a manhwa focused on Cha Hae-In.
